:ais: Przejście na binarki Termux

Cześć, czy ruszyło coś w temacie z DEV3 przejścia na TERMUX ??

Postanowiłem dołączyć do grona kamikadze i spróbować przejść na Termux. Na początek poszło DEV-1. No i wygląda, że mam teraz taki sobie przycisk do papieru :frowning:
Odebrałem prawa administratora dla apki AIS Server. Następne odinstalowałem AIS Server, AIS i AIS Launcher, jak to było w instrukcji i kontakt z DEV1 się urwał…
Po twardym restarcie pojawia się logo AIS, potem animowane logo AIS a potem czarny ekran i jest on stabilny, nic się nie dzieje. Muszka z pilota radiowego pokazuje wskaźnik i to wszystko…
Jakieś pomysły?

Czy przypadkiem nie została w bramce karta pamięci lub pendrive?

Ta sytuacja trochę kojarzy mi się z moimi próbami postawienia CoreELEC’a i samą procedurą…
System nie startował bo miałem jakieś błędy na karcie… ale próbował właśnie z karty.

Nie, po prostu jak odinstalowałem te 3 apki jednocześnie to nie było launchera, więc nic się nie pojawiło jako apka startowa…
Ale miałem niezbyt dokładnie skalibrowany ekran monitora więc przypadkiem wjechałem myszką na górną “ramkę” i rozwinęły mi się 4 ikonki, a jedną z nich był nieodinstalowany AIS Screen Stream, który udało mi się wystartować a z niego przejść do przeglądarki Chrome i po paru perturbacjach ściągnąć w końcu instalkę AIS Server Termux no i właśnie ściąga pakiety… może coś z tego jednak będzie :wink:

No i coś wyszło…


Ciekawe dlaczego nie widać wersji Andka?

OK, już widać, pogoniłem jeszcze DEV3 na Termuksa, ale tym razem nie usuwałem od razu AIS Launchera i AIS Dom, tylko dopiero po instalacji AIS Server, przy czym AIS Launcher mi się aktualizował, nie było opcji odinstalowania.

No ale to były Pikusie, bo puste bramki, z PRO1 już będzie jazda, bo to produkcyjna bramka i wszystko na niej siedzi…

1 polubienie

znaczy się

pkg install postgresql

?

Szczerze to nie pamiętam. Za to pamiętam, żę bardzo mi pomógł @SebiCo - dzięki raz jeszcze :+1:.
Więc poczytaj naszą dyskusję po moim przejściu na Termux w tym temacie:

Dzięki.
Poradziłem sobie z opisem od Jolki, robiąc tylko poprawkę na nową ścieżkę do plików.
No ale byłem zdziwiony, że w podanej lokalizacji baza postgresql już sobie czekała z bazą ha i użytkownikiem ais…
Wystarczyło ją tylko odpalić w pm2 :slight_smile:

Kopia przywraca całe katalogi, więc to raczej nie jest dziwne. W Linux wszystko jest plikiem :wink:

Bramka PRO1 zmigrowana do Termux :slight_smile:
Musiałem po odtworzeniu kopii uruchomić proces PostgreSQL i dodałem tę bazę jako zewnętrzną :wink:
Odpaliłem też z powodzeniem Node Red z kopii.
Oczywiście do odtworzenia była też konfiguracja MQTT, ale byłem na to przygotowany.
No ale najważniejsze, to znowu encje Zigbee zaczęły działać! Aktualizują się (nawet climate!) i można nimi sterować :slight_smile:
Czyli czekam teraz na grudzień i Nikodema PROD :wink:

@jolka mała uwaga do logów. Teraz mqtt sieje do logów jak szalone, docelowo tak ma być? Wcześniej było mniej rozmowne :wink: No i moja uwaga do kolorowania właściciela logu. Wcześniej miałem uwagę, że ais nadaje na czerwono, bez względu na to czy komunikat jest błędem czy nie, ale teraz wszystkie procesy nadają defaultowo na czerwono, co jest trochę mało informacyjne…

EDIT: przepraszam, w tym nawale logów ciężko było zauważyć, że zigbee2mqtt nadaje na zielono :wink:

Informacyjnie możesz zawęzić logi do danej usługi/procesu pm2
np:
pm2 logs mqtt

pm2 logs zigbee

Tak, wiem, korzystam z tej opcji, ale najczęściej odpalam dla wszystkich :wink:

o właśnie też to zauważyłem, że mqtt wali jaki szalone po przejściu na termux, nawet się zastanawiam czy może gdzieś w tym moja wina?

U mnie to samo masa logów mqtt

Od dłuższego czasu planowałem postawić wszystko od nowa, stąd też wykonałem pełny reset aplikacji. Wgrany termux, pakiety się pobierają (po wgranym termuxie, też były już próby z pełnym resetem)


ą, choć przy 3 z nich jest błąd.
Następnie Launcher się odpala, udaje się nawet założyć konto (celowo nie przywracam żadnego backupu), dodają się domyślne integracje i potem bramka po jakimkolwiek restarcie już nie wstaje.
Wisi na planszy “łączenie z ‘ip’ lub ‘tunnel’”
Nie da się dostać do konsoli z poziomu przeglądarki i portu 8888, a na bramce podłączonej pod monitor, przy wejściu w konsolę widać planszę jak przy pobieraniu pakietów termux, a następnie samoczynnie znowu próbuje się odpalić launcher i pozostaje tylko kolejny pełny reset.

Wygląda, jakby termux w kółko próbował dossać jakieś pakiety?

Wcześniej była próba akutalizacji do wydanej wczoraj bety 2022.10.0, ale tam to już w ogóle wszystko się posypało i nawet konsoli nie miała uprawnień, każde polecenie było “aborted”, ale to w osobnym wątku.

Musi być jakiś błąd kompilacji / pobieranych pakietów albo domyślnie instalowanie po starcie integracje coś mieszają.

Bardzo dużo problemów od momentu przejścia na termux, może przydałoby się jakieś wsparcie @Celina lub @jolka ?

Moja bramka to dev1 i nawet jako tako działała już na termuxie od kilku tygodni, aż do momentu pełnego resetu

2 polubienia

Zrób pełny reset, zainstaluj poprzednie oprogramowanie i zmigruj do Termuksa. Może jeszcze Termux nie jest gotowy do instalacji na czystą bramkę?

ok, tylko to sposób na tymczasowe obejście problemu, a nie jego rozwiązanie.

Daj znać czy się udało?

pełny reset bez termuxa, ale brak teraz jakiejkolwiek aktualizacji dostępnej, nawet po przejściu na alfe…

Spokojnie jak pójdzie aplikacja Termux to pociągnie aktualne wydanie.

1 polubienie